zoukankan      html  css  js  c++  java
  • 初始网络编程

                         服务器端
    # #导入socket模块 import socket
    # #创建socket对象,创建了一个手机
    # server = socket.socket()
    #
    # #给程序设置一个ip地址和端口号,买了个手机卡
    # ip_port = ('192.168.12.11',8002)
    #
    # #绑定ip地址和端口,插卡
    # server.bind(ip_port)
    #
    # #监听ip地址和端口,简称开机
    # server.listen()
    #
    # #等待建立连接, conn是连接通道,addr是客户端的地址
    # conn,addr = server.accept()
    #
    # #服务端通过conn连接通道来收发消息,通过recv方法,recv里面的参数是字节(B),1024的意思1024B=1KB
    # from_client_msg = conn.recv(1024)
    #
    # print('高旺说:',from_client_msg.decode('utf-8'))
    #
    # #回复消息:通过send方法,参数必须是字节类型的,
    # conn.send('约吗'.encode('utf-8'))
    #
    # #关闭通道,关电话,通过close方法
    # conn.close()
    # #关闭socket对象,关机
    # server.close()
                        客户端
    #导入socket
    # import socket
    # #创建一个socket对象
    # client = socket.socket()
    # #找到服务端的ip地址和端口
    # server_ip_port = ('192.168.12.11',8002)
    # #连接服务端的应用程序,通过connect方法,参数是服务端的ip地址和端口,打电话
    # client.connect(server_ip_port)
    #
    # #发消息,用的send方法,但是调用者是client的socket对象
    # client.send('约吗?'.encode('utf-8'))
    #
    # from_server_msg = client.recv(1024)
    #
    # print('高旺的女朋友说:',from_server_msg.decode('utf-8'))
    # conn.close()/
    # client.close()
  • 相关阅读:
    ActiveMQ
    bzoj 3039 悬线法求最大01子矩阵
    bzoj 1015 并查集
    bzoj 3037 贪心
    bzoj 2599 数分治 点剖分
    bzoj 2743 树状数组离线查询
    bzoj 2141 线段树套平衡树
    bzoj 3171 费用流
    bzoj 2751 快速幂
    bzoj 2956 数学展开,分段处理
  • 原文地址:https://www.cnblogs.com/heheda123456/p/10209795.html
Copyright © 2011-2022 走看看